• 제목/요약/키워드: 테스트 프로세스 개선

검색결과 62건 처리시간 0.034초

시험 프로세스 개선 측면에서의 MND-TMM과 CMMI의 비교 분석 (Test Process Improvement Based Analysis of MND-TMM and CMMI)

  • 강명묵;류호연;백종문;임규형
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2008년도 추계학술발표대회
    • /
    • pp.535-538
    • /
    • 2008
  • 국방에서 사용되는 소프트웨어는 미션 크리티컬(Mission Critical)한 고 품질의 소프트웨어가 요구된다. 이를 위해 많은 조직에서는 전체 개발 프로세스를 개선하기 위한 목적으로 CMMI를 적용하고 있으나 테스트 프로세스를 개선하는 데는 부족함이 있어 고 품질의 소프트웨어를 생산하는데 어려움이 따르고 있다. 더욱이 국방이라는 특수한 도메인에서는 그러한 현상이 빈번히 발생함에 따라 국방 도메인에 적합한 테스트 성숙도 모델의 필요성이 제기되었으며 이를 위해 국방 시험 성숙도 모델(MND-TMM)이 개발되었고 현재 시험 적용 중이다. 본 논문에서는 현재 무기체계 소프트웨어를 개발하는 조직에서 전체 개발 프로세스를 개선하기 위해 CMMI를 적용하고 있기에 테스트 프로세스를 개선하기 위한 모델인 MND-TMM과 CMMI를 비교 분석하여 두 모델의 강점과 약점을 제시하고 상호연계방안을 모색한다. 상호연계를 통해 국방 소프트웨어 개발 조직에서는 두 모델을 적용하는데 있어 비용 및 시간을 줄이고 소프트웨어의 품질을 향상시킬 것으로 기대한다.

품질 향상을 위한 테스트 프로세스 모델 제안 (Quality Based Test Process Model Suggestion)

  • 임응호;최진영
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2004년도 추계학술발표논문집(상)
    • /
    • pp.271-274
    • /
    • 2004
  • 소프트웨어 품질에 대한 관심이 증가하면서 품질을 측정하고, 평가, 개선하기 위한 테스트 프로세스에 대한 필요성이 대두했다. 현재, IEEE/Std 829-1983, SEI 의 CMM, DoD 의 MIL-STD-498, ANSI/IEEE 의 SVVP등 테스트 프로세스에 대한 여러 국제적 지침이 많이 있지만 그 수준이 너무 일반적이고 개괄적이어서 실제 소프트웨어 개발에 적용되기엔 어려움이 있다. 본 논문에서는 IEEE/Std 829-1983 과 현재 국내 A 대기업에서 실시되고 있는 테스트 프로세스를 소개하고 이들을 조사, 비교 분석해 실제 소프트웨어 개발에 적용할 수 있는 품질 관리 계획 내 포함될 수 있는 엔터프라이즈 테스트 프로세스(Enterprise Test Process)를 제안한다.

  • PDF

테스트 프로세스 심사 방법 개선 방안 (Improvement of Test Process Assessment Method)

  • 이은표;김진수;김정아;이병걸
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2007년도 한국컴퓨터종합학술대회논문집 Vol.34 No.1 (B)
    • /
    • pp.111-116
    • /
    • 2007
  • 최근 업계에서는 테스트의 중요성이 대두되면서 테스트 활동에 대한 테스트 성숙도 모델 적용을 통해 테스트 프로세스의 지속적인 개선을 도모하고 있다. 하지만 기존의 모델들이 외국 기업의 소프트웨어 개발 환경을 기반으로 하고 있어 중소 규모의 소프트웨어 개발 업체에서 이를 적용하기에는 비용과 기간 면에서 어려움이 따른다. 또한 체계적인 심사방법을 제시하지 못하고 있어 성숙도 모델의 적용에 대한 평가가 어려운 실정이다. 본 논문에서는 심사의 객관성을 확보하는 동시에 심사 비용 및 기간을 축소할 수 있는 방안을 제시한다. 심사의 객관성 확보를 위해 심사 대상 문서의 연관관계 테이블과 활용 기록을 기준으로 문서 심사를 수행하도록 하였으며, 심사 기간과 비용을 줄이기 위해 검증(Verification) 활동 중심의 문서심사를 문서 활용도에 대한 심사로 대체하고 각종 검토 활동 및 교육 활동을 통폐합 하였다. 개선된 심사모델을 도입함으로써 심사 기간이 단축될 수 있으며, 정형화된 심사 지침서의 활용을 통해 객관성을 확보할 수 있는 효과를 기대할 수 있다.

  • PDF

소프트웨어 품질 향상을 위한 SETP 테스트 프로세스 모델 (SETP Test Process Model for Software Quality Improvement)

  • 오혜진;서주영;최병주
    • 한국IT서비스학회:학술대회논문집
    • /
    • 한국IT서비스학회 2006년도 춘계학술대회
    • /
    • pp.293-300
    • /
    • 2006
  • 소프트웨어 개발 프로세스의 평가를 통해 소프트웨어 프로덕트의 품질을 높이려는 다양한 시도들이 행해지고 있다. 소프트웨어 테스트 프로세스는 소프트웨어 개발 프로세스 중에서도 소프트웨어 프로덕트 품질 향상에 직접적인 영향을 끼치므로, 이에 대한 체계적인 개선이 필요하다. 본 논문에서는 프로세스의 품질과 프로덕프의 품질을 동시에 고려하는 소프트웨어 테스팅 모델인 SETP(Simple and Effective Test Process)모델을 제안한다.

  • PDF

이종 임베디드 테스팅을 위한 MDA (Model Driven Architecture)기반의 테스트 프로세스 개선 및 확장에 관한 연구 (Test Process Improvement and Extension Based On Model Driven Architecture(MDA) For Heterogeneous Embedded Testing)

  • 김동호;손현승;김우열;김영철
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2012년도 춘계학술발표대회
    • /
    • pp.1239-1242
    • /
    • 2012
  • 현재 소비자의 요구에 따라 다양한 타켓 상에서 임베디드 소프트웨어 개발이 폭주되고 있다. 같은 서비스를 제공하는 어플리케이션을 다양한 플랫폼에 맞게 개발하려면 많은 시간과 비용이 소모된다. 또한 이를 위한 테스트 비용도 증가하게 된다. 이는 테스트 비용의 지출이 전체 개발비용에 막대한 영향을 미친다. 그래서 다양한 플랫폼 상에서의 테스트 비용을 감소하기 위해 기존 소프트웨어공학 기법 중 하나인 Model Driven Architecture (MDA)를 적용한 기존 임베디드 개발기법에 테스트 프로세스를 개선 및 강화할 것을 제안한다[1 ][2]. 또한 다양한 타켓에 맞는 이종 테스트케이스 개발에 밑거름이 될 것이다.

X-Forms 기반 UI 소프트웨어의 테스트 프로세스 사이트 구축 (Test Process Site Construction of X-Forms Base UI Software)

  • 이승혁;한정수
    • 한국콘텐츠학회:학술대회논문집
    • /
    • 한국콘텐츠학회 2007년도 추계 종합학술대회 논문집
    • /
    • pp.591-594
    • /
    • 2007
  • X-Internet과 X-Forms 기반의 웹 UI 개발 툴로 개발되어 클라이언트 상에서 운영되는 소프트웨어 대한 테스트 프로세스를 제안하고 사이트를 구축한다. 이러한 소프트웨어는 개발이 완료되어 운영되는 과정에도 사용자의 요구, 성능 향상, 기능 개선, 기능 추가 등의 이유로 변경이 된다. 변경된 소프트웨어를 테스트하기 위해 V-모델을 확장, 변형한 테스트 프로세스를 제안한다. 제안한 테스트 프로세스는 테스트 목표와 그 목표를 달성하기 위한 활동을 정의하는 테스트 계획을 시작으로, 테스트 케이스와 데이터를 식별하고 환경을 구축하는 분석과 설계, 테스트 케이스를 명세화하고 테스트 방법론을 적용하는 구현과 실현, 리포팅과 산출물을 정리하는 테스트 마감 단계로 진행된다. 본 논문은 테스트 프로세스를 효율적으로 관리하고 기록하여 시간과 비용을 절감할 수 있는 사이트를 구축한다.

  • PDF

프로세스 영역 의존성을 이용한 TMMi 레벨 1 단계화 방안 (A Decomposition Method for TMMi Maturity Level 1 using Process Area Dependency Analysis)

  • 김선준;류성열;오기성
    • 한국컴퓨터정보학회논문지
    • /
    • 제15권12호
    • /
    • pp.189-196
    • /
    • 2010
  • 국내 소프트웨어 테스트 성숙도 수준은 TMMi 기준으로 대부분 레벨 2 이하다. 성숙도 개선의 첫째 조건은 현재 성숙도 수준을 정확히 아는데 있다. TMMi에는 레벨 1 정의가 없지만, 같은 레벨 1 조직이라도 성숙도 수준은 분명 차이가 있다. 이에 본 연구는 레벨 1 조직의 성숙도 수준을 정확히 파악하고, 레벨 1 조직이 개선 노력을 줄이면서 레벨 2를 달성하는 방안을 제시한다. 레벨 2에서 의존성이 있는 서브 프랙티스를 해당 프로세스 영역과 그룹화해서 레벨 1을 3단계로 새롭게 정의했다. 의존성을 이용한 이유는 의존성 있는 프랙티스 끼리 묶어 프로세스를 개선하면 프랙티스 여러 개를 한꺼번에 달성하는 효과를 얻을 수 있기 때문이다. 3단계화 적정성을 검증해서 레벨 1 조직의 성숙도 수준을 정확히 평가했고, 다음 단계 개선 목표와 방향을 구체적으로 설정할 수 있음을 알았다.

이관 관리 프로세스 개선을 위한 메타데이터 관리시스템 구현 및 테스트 (Implementation and Test Meta Data Management System for Transformation Managing Process Enhancement)

  • 양승연;박석천;이영상;이상화;김기태
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2013년도 추계학술발표대회
    • /
    • pp.1252-1255
    • /
    • 2013
  • 오늘날 급변하는 IT 환경에 신속하게 대응하기 위한 기업의 데이터 관리시스템의 중요성이 강조되고 있다. 특히, 최근에는 기업의 시스템이 복잡해지고 데이터의 규모가 점점 대형화 되면서 기업들은 데이터 관리를 위해 메타데이터 관리시스템의 활용이 증가하고 있다. 하지만 현재 도입되는 메타데이터 관리시스템은 테이블 이관 시 모델과 실제 데이터베이스 사이의 정합성을 유지하기 위해 불필요한 반복적인 프로세스를 수행해야 하는 문제점을 가진다. 따라서 본 논문에서는 이러한 문제점을 해결하기 위하여 이관관리 프로세스 개선을 위한 메타데이터 관리시스템을 구현하고 테스트 하였다.